Cummings’s testimony shows why we still need zero-Covid
The government is playing Russian roulette with the virus and with people’s lives, writes DIANE ABBOTT MP

DOMINIC CUMMINGS’s appearance before a parliamentary select committee was one of those rare occasions when the viewer is left speechless with shock and anger.
And, even more unusually, this was not because there were any great revelations.
Cummings simply confirmed all our worst suspicions about how the government handled and continues to handle the pandemic.
